I loved the Moses hotel in Petra. The beds are super comfortable, it is modern and has nice views in the upper rooms. Very clean and with easy access to water, hairdryer, etc. Next door there is a grocery store which is super practical and in the room you have a mini fridge which is a plus. The only thing is that it is a bit far from the entrance to the Petra visitor centre, to go there without problem because it is downhill, but the return is a very steep half-hour climb. The taxis try to take advantage and ask you for 5jd, but that fare should not be more than 3jd, so I advise you to try to haggle because in that sense they take advantage a little. (They do not put the taximeter on and charge you almost 7 euros for 2 kilometres). But the place is exceptional, a good hotel.
